Marathon Digital Holdings, Inc., a prominent cryptocurrency mining company, experienced a 1.6% increase in its stock price, reaching $9.14 per share. Despite this rise, the trading volume was 23% lower than its average daily volume. Analysts have expressed
varied opinions on the company's performance, with some lowering their price targets and others maintaining neutral or negative ratings. Cantor Fitzgerald reduced its price target from $21 to $11 but kept an 'overweight' rating, while HC Wainwright maintained a 'neutral' stance. Weiss Ratings downgraded the stock to a 'sell' rating, and Morgan Stanley initiated coverage with an 'underweight' rating and an $8 price target. The consensus rating for Marathon Digital is 'Hold' with a $20 price target.
